WebOct 21, 2024 · Hit Windows+I to open the Settings app and then click the “System” category. On the System page, click the “Power & Sleep” tab on the left. On the right, click the “Additional Power Settings” link under the “Related Settings” section. In the window that pops up, click “Show Additional Plans” and then click the “Ultimate ... WebPower Interface (ACPI) dump utility to check the number of P-states published by BIOS when turbo mode is enabled. The system will have one extra P-state when turbo mode is enabled. WebAug 27, 2024 · How to figure out whether your computer is using UEFI or BIOS boot mode? Actually, you can check it by yourself. Just follow the step below. Step 1: Press Windows + R to bring up Run window.. Step 2: Input msinfo32 and click OK button to open System Information.. WebJul 23, 2013 · The Configured Max CPU Power option is the new power management mode introduced in the Haswell platform that allows the direct control of the maximum power consumption of the CPU. Enable this option to allow the utilization of the cTDP power management under the Max Power Saving mode. Considering not all users use …
